Quote:
Originally Posted by TopazBrandon View Post
Are Work VS-KF Faces flippable? Example: 18x10+45 is now a 18x10-45.
VS-KF's are not flippable. I don't think any of the reverse lip Work's (VSXX, Equips, VSMX, Rezax, etc) are flippable. In fact, I believe only step lip wheels are flippable at all but I haven't confirmed that. If you look at the barrels, they have dip down to given the tire space to mount easier. This "dip" will get in the way of the face. The lips are straight so they don't get in the way.

Quote:
Originally Posted by lewisfk View Post
Any paint gurus in the house? Nissan R35 paint code, need to source a gallon of this paint Nissan Titanium KAC
I had to look it up to confirm it but the PPG number is 919010. Its the same paint code as the Infiniti G37, M35 and M45 "Desert Shadow". You should be able to go to your local Finish Master and ask them for Nissan KAC and they should ask you what brand you want (although I think PPG is the only one with it atm). If you ask for the 919010, then they should get you PPG. Some Sherwin Williams also do automotive so its worth asking there too.

Quote:
Originally Posted by TopazBrandon View Post
When buying new lips. More $ per inch lip or is a 2" lip and a 5" lip the same price from a company? Different lip/barrel materials? (NEW To this ss)
It is a little dependent on the size of the lip but they're close. For instance, at Vrwheels 4.5" and lower is $200. 5" and 5.5" is $220 and 6" is $240. Wheel flip is just about at $200 for every size except 7" which is $220. All the lips you get from any company, including custom made, should be forged aluminum( 6061 specifically).

Also as a side thing; http://workwheelsonline.com/ sells a lot of the stuff to refinish Work wheels including valve stems, centercaps, wheel decals, hardware etc. Wheelflip sells a sealant for 3-piece wheels which you will need but you can use just about any sealant. I've used RTV ultra black on a bunch of sets with no problems.
